How to prepare for a job interview at Ribbons and Reeves Limited
✨Know Your Curriculum
Familiarise yourself with the English curriculum for secondary education. Be ready to discuss how you would engage students with different learning styles and abilities. This shows your commitment to teaching and understanding of the subject matter.
✨Showcase Your Passion
During the interview, let your enthusiasm for teaching English shine through.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your love for literature and language. This can help create a connection with the interviewers and demonstrate your dedication.
✨Prepare for Behaviour Management Questions
Expect questions about classroom management and behaviour strategies. Think of specific examples from your past experiences where you've successfully managed a challenging situation. This will show that you can maintain a positive learning environment.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, have a few thoughtful questions prepared about the school's culture, support for teachers, or professional development opportunities. This not only shows your interest in the role but also helps you assess if the school is the right fit for you.
